.Footer-module__Grjkva__footerContainer{margin-top:var(--section-padding-xl);background-color:var(--color-primary);width:100%;max-width:100%;color:var(--color-black)}.Footer-module__Grjkva__contentContainer{max-width:var(--max-page-width);padding:var(--section-padding-lg) var(--section-padding-sm);align-items:center;gap:var(--section-padding-lg);flex-direction:column;margin:0 auto;display:flex}.Footer-module__Grjkva__logoContainer{place-items:center;width:100%;display:grid}.Footer-module__Grjkva__logoContainer img{width:64px;height:auto}.Footer-module__Grjkva__upperPart,.Footer-module__Grjkva__lowerPart{grid-template-columns:1fr min-content;width:100%;min-width:0;display:grid}.Footer-module__Grjkva__upperPart ul{padding:0;list-style:none}.Footer-module__Grjkva__upperPart li,.Footer-module__Grjkva__upperPart a{color:var(--color-black);margin-bottom:var(--section-padding-sm);text-decoration:none}.Footer-module__Grjkva__upperPart li:hover,.Footer-module__Grjkva__upperPart a:hover{text-decoration:underline}.Footer-module__Grjkva__accreditationLinks a{font-size:.4rem}.Footer-module__Grjkva__copyRightAndContactInfo{text-align:right;flex-direction:column;width:max-content;display:flex}.Footer-module__Grjkva__termsAndOtherLinks{place-items:center;width:100%;display:grid}.Footer-module__Grjkva__termsAndOtherLinks ul{justify-content:center;gap:var(--section-padding-sm);flex-flow:row;margin:0;padding:0;list-style:none;display:flex}.Footer-module__Grjkva__termsListItem{align-items:center;gap:.35rem;display:inline-flex}.Footer-module__Grjkva__termsSeparator{margin-right:0}a.Footer-module__Grjkva__accreditationLink,a.Footer-module__Grjkva__socialLink,a.Footer-module__Grjkva__contactLink,a.Footer-module__Grjkva__termsLink{color:var(--color-black);text-decoration:none}a.Footer-module__Grjkva__accreditationLink:hover,a.Footer-module__Grjkva__socialLink:hover,a.Footer-module__Grjkva__contactLink:hover,a.Footer-module__Grjkva__termsLink:hover{text-decoration:underline}.Footer-module__Grjkva__socialLinks{gap:var(--section-padding-sm);flex-direction:row;display:flex}.Footer-module__Grjkva__socialLinks a{place-items:center;width:32px;height:32px;display:grid}.Footer-module__Grjkva__socialLinks img{width:auto;height:24px}@media (max-width:700px){.Footer-module__Grjkva__contentContainer{gap:var(--section-padding-md)}.Footer-module__Grjkva__upperPart,.Footer-module__Grjkva__lowerPart{text-align:center;justify-items:center;gap:var(--section-padding-sm);grid-template-columns:1fr}.Footer-module__Grjkva__copyRightAndContactInfo{text-align:center;overflow-wrap:anywhere;width:100%;min-width:0;max-width:100%}.Footer-module__Grjkva__termsAndOtherLinks ul{flex-wrap:wrap}}
.Header-module__ldgnoG__header{z-index:9999;width:100%;height:min-content;max-width:var(--max-page-width);grid-template-columns:1fr auto;align-items:center;margin:0 auto;display:grid}.Header-module__ldgnoG__logo img{filter:invert()brightness(1.2);align-self:center;width:32px}.Header-module__ldgnoG__blackHeader .Header-module__ldgnoG__logo img{filter:none}.Header-module__ldgnoG__logoContainer{place-items:center;width:44px;height:44px;display:grid}.Header-module__ldgnoG__logo h1{color:var(--color-white);align-self:end;margin:0;font-size:1.25rem}.Header-module__ldgnoG__blackHeader .Header-module__ldgnoG__logo h1{color:var(--color-black)}.Header-module__ldgnoG__logo{gap:var(--section-padding-sm);height:44px;display:flex}
.Hero-module__JgYmMq__widthContainer{background-color:var(--color-primary);position:relative;overflow:hidden}.Hero-module__JgYmMq__heroImage{filter:brightness(.5);object-fit:cover;object-position:center;z-index:1;width:calc(100% - 16px);max-width:1300px;height:calc(100vh - 16px);position:absolute;inset:8px}@media (min-width:1100px){.Hero-module__JgYmMq__heroImage{left:50%;transform:translate(-50%)}}.Hero-module__JgYmMq__hero{padding:var(--section-padding-sm);width:100%;max-width:var(--max-page-width);flex-direction:column;height:100vh;display:flex;position:relative}.Hero-module__JgYmMq__hero>*{z-index:2}.Hero-module__JgYmMq__hero>div{padding-inline:var(--section-padding-lg);text-align:center;justify-content:center;align-items:center;gap:var(--section-padding-lg);flex-direction:column;height:100%;display:flex}.Hero-module__JgYmMq__widthContainerWhiteBackground{background-color:var(--color-white);z-index:1;width:100%;height:100px;position:absolute;bottom:0;left:0}.Hero-module__JgYmMq__title{font-size:2.5rem;color:var(--color-white)!important}
